Property description

Most conveniently located for local shops, the R4 bus route, and Orpington mainline station, this particularly spacious three bedroom semi-detached bungalow is offered to the market with no onward chain. Tastefully decorated throughout, accommodation comprises: Sizeable entrance hall, lounge overlooking the rear garden, a breakfasting kitchen, three good sized bedrooms, and a shower room. To the front, there is a private driveway, and a detached garage (ideal for storage) at the side, with slightly restricted access. The lovely secluded rear garden with a selection of plants and shrubs, as well as lawn and terrace, measures approximately 67'0". Very popular local schools are close by, including Newstead Wood School For Girls, Darrick Wood, Tubbenden, and St Olaves Boys' Grammar School. Orpington High Street offers a good selection of shops, coffee shops, bars and restaurants, as well as gyms, leisure centre and Odeon Cinema. Viewing comes highly recommended.

Entrance Hall

A particularly spacious entrance hall. UPVc leaded light and stained glass effect entrance door to front. Single panel radiator. Deep airing cupboard housing hot water cylinder. Glazed panel onto the kitchen. Access to the loft space.

Lounge

Double glazed sliding patio doors leading to the rear garden. Coving to ceiling. Feature marble effect fireplace with decorative mantel over and with coal effect gas fire.

Kitchen

Fitted with a range of wall, base and drawer units and shelving. Colour coordinated roll edge work tops with inset one and a half bowl sink unit with "swan neck" mixer tap over. Partly tiled walls with decorative inserts. Downlighting. Under cabinet lighting. Coving to ceiling. Double panel radiator. Larder cupboard with window and tiled shelf (and housing electric meter). Integrated appliances to include: Four burner gas hob with extractor hood over and with oven under; dishwasher; under-counter fridge; and under-counter freezer. Double glazed window overlooking the rear garden.

Lobby

Quarry tiled flooring. Double glazed diamond leaded light effect door to side. Deep utility shelf and with space and plumbing for washing machine beneath. Gas meter. Recess with wall mounted gas fired central heating boiler.

Bedroom 1

Double glazed diamond leaded light effect window to front. Double panel radiator. Fitted with a range of bedroom furniture to one wall including wardrobes, and dressing table unit.

Bedroom 2

Double glazed diamond leaded light effect window to front, and with single panel radiator beneath. Coving to ceiling. Fitted with a range of bedroom furniture to one wall including wardrobes (some with glass display fronts), and dressing table unit.

Bedroom 3

Double glazed diamond leaded light effect window to side, and with single panel radiator beneath.

Shower Room

Fitted with a white contemporary style suite comprising:- corner shower cubicle; WC with concealed cistern; and vanity wash hand basin with drawer unit beneath. Marble effect fully tiled walls with decorative border, and ceramic tiled flooring. Single panel radiator. Downlighting. Extractor fan. Double glazed diamond leaded light effect frosted window to side.

Front Garden

Laid to lawn with hedge and shrub borders. Crazy paved driveway. Timber double gates (with slightly restricted access) lead to:-

Garage / Store

Detached. Up and over door to front. Personal door to side. Window to rear. Power and lighting.

Rear Garden (approximately 20.42m (approximately 67'0"))

Immediately behind the property, and to the side, there is terraced area, and two electronically controlled garden awnings. Then, mainly laid to lawn with well stocked and established plant, shrub and hedge borders. Trees. The rear boundary is secluded with conifer and hedge screening. Timber garden shed. Greenhouse. Outside lighting. Outside water tap.
